    Shots fired, two in custody in Germantown

    MEMPHIS, Tenn. — A man and a juvenile are in custody after a Germantown Police officer heard shots fired near an apartment complex Thursday.

    Police say the officer was completing a traffic stop at 1:40 p.m. near Wolf River Boulevard and Miller Farms Road when he heard gunfire, then saw two people running toward The Bridges at Germantown apartments.

    The officer took one person into custody and another was found in the apartment complex a few minutes later by responding officers.

    No injuries were reported and police are investigating.
